Machine learning offers a plethora of algorithms designed to analyze data, yet none match the accuracy of Support Vector Machines (SVMs). Originally developed for classification, SVMs have evolved into versatile tools used for regression, outlier detection, and text processing. Their ability to handle high-dimensional data makes them the go-to algorithm when other techniques fall short.
But what contributes to the exceptional performance of SVMs? The secret lies in their ability to create optimal boundaries between different groups in a dataset, achieving the highest possible classification accuracy.
At its heart, a Support Vector Machine aims to find the best dividing line—or decision boundary—between various categories in a dataset. Imagine two categories of objects scattered on a graph. SVM strives to draw the most ideal line, known as a hyperplane, between them. The goal is to position this boundary so that the distance between each category’s nearest points is maximized. These nearest points are called “support vectors,” and they play a crucial role in determining the decision boundary.
This approach is called maximizing the margin. A larger margin helps the model generalize better to new data, minimizing the risk of misclassification. While cleanly separated data makes this task straightforward, real-world datasets often contain overlapping points, outliers, or non-linear distributions, complicating classification. Here, SVM’s strength in mapping data to higher dimensions becomes invaluable.
Not all problems can be solved with a simple linear boundary. Some datasets require more sophisticated techniques to distinguish between various groups. SVM addresses this challenge using the kernel trick. This method allows SVM to transform data into higher dimensions, where it can be more easily separated by a boundary.
If a dataset seems inseparable in two dimensions, for instance, SVM can project it into a three-dimensional space where a clear boundary emerges. Common kernel functions include:
By selecting the appropriate kernel, SVM can adapt to various data structures, making it a highly flexible machine learning tool.
SVM’s versatility extends well beyond theoretical applications. Many industries utilize it to classify and predict patterns in large datasets. One of the most prevalent areas is image classification, where SVMs help distinguish between objects in photos, recognize handwriting, and detect medical anomalies in MRI scans. Their ability to handle high-dimensional data makes them especially effective in face detection and optical character recognition (OCR) tasks.
Another significant application is in text and speech recognition. Email spam filters, for example, often rely on SVMs to differentiate between legitimate and junk messages. Similarly, voice recognition systems use SVMs to identify spoken words and phrases with impressive accuracy.
In the financial sector, SVMs identify fraudulent transactions by detecting unusual spending patterns. Since fraud detection involves recognizing subtle deviations from normal activities, SVMs’ capability to handle high-dimensional data is particularly beneficial.
SVMs also play a vital role in healthcare. In disease prediction, they analyze medical records to identify early signs of conditions like cancer, heart disease, or diabetes. By training an SVM on extensive datasets containing past patient data, doctors can make informed predictions about a patient’s health risks.
SVMs offer several advantages, making them a preferred choice for many machine learning tasks. Their greatest strength is their robustness in handling high- dimensional data. Unlike other algorithms that falter with numerous features, SVM excels even when datasets contain thousands of variables.
Another significant advantage is their generalization ability. By maximizing the margin between classes, SVM often produces models that perform well on unseen data, reducing the likelihood of overfitting. Additionally, SVMs are effective even with relatively small datasets, making them an excellent choice when labeled data is limited.
Despite these strengths, SVMs are not without limitations. One major challenge is computational complexity. Training an SVM, especially with non-linear kernels on large datasets, can be time-consuming and require substantial computational resources. This makes it less practical for big data applications compared to algorithms like deep learning.
Another drawback is their sensitivity to noisy data. Since SVM relies heavily on support vectors, outliers can significantly impact the decision boundary. If the dataset contains excessive noise, SVM may struggle to generalize effectively.
Finally, selecting the right kernel function can be challenging. While SVM provides several kernel options, choosing the best one for a given dataset requires trial and error. An unsuitable kernel choice can lead to suboptimal results, necessitating domain expertise to fine-tune the model effectively.
Support Vector Machines remain a cornerstone of machine learning due to their exceptional accuracy, versatility, and ability to handle complex datasets. Whether classifying images, recognizing text, detecting fraud, or predicting diseases, SVMs have proven their reliability across various applications. Their strength lies in creating optimal decision boundaries, especially in high-dimensional spaces. Despite computational challenges, SVMs continue to be a preferred tool for many real-world tasks, particularly when data is limited or high precision is required. As machine learning evolves, SVMs remain highly relevant, serving as a powerful alternative to deep learning methods for numerous classification and regression problems.
Learn simple steps to estimate the time and cost of a machine learning project, from planning to deployment and risk management
Learn how AI-powered predictive maintenance reduces Downtime and costs by predicting equipment failures in advance.
AI-driven credit scoring improves fairness, speeds loan approvals and provides accurate, data-driven decisions.
Learn how transfer learning helps AI learn faster, saving time and data, improving efficiency in machine learning models.
Natural Language Processing Succinctly and Deep Learning for NLP and Speech Recognition are the best books to master NLP
To decide which of the shelf and custom-built machine learning models best fit your company, weigh their advantages and drawbacks
Discover how AI is changing finance by automating tasks, reducing errors, and delivering smarter decision-making tools.
Explore the top 7 machine learning tools for beginners in 2025. Search for hands-on learning and experience-friendly platforms.
Discover how linear algebra and calculus are essential in machine learning and optimizing models effectively.
What’s the difference between deep learning and neural networks? While both play a role in AI, they serve different purposes. Explore how deep learning expands on neural network architecture to power modern AI models
Discover the essential skills, tools, and steps to become a Machine Learning Engineer in 2025.
Understanding AI trainer roles is crucial in the evolving world of artificial intelligence. Learn how these professionals shape and refine machine learning models for accuracy and efficiency.
Hyundai creates new brand to focus on the future of software-defined vehicles, transforming how cars adapt, connect, and evolve through intelligent software innovation.
Discover how Deloitte's Zora AI is reshaping enterprise automation and intelligent decision-making at Nvidia GTC 2025.
Discover how Nvidia, Google, and Disney's partnership at GTC aims to revolutionize robot AI infrastructure, enhancing machine learning and movement in real-world scenarios.
What is Nvidia's new AI Factory Platform, and how is it redefining AI reasoning? Here's how GTC 2025 set a new direction for intelligent computing.
Can talking cars become the new normal? A self-driving taxi prototype is testing a conversational AI agent that goes beyond basic commands—here's how it works and why it matters.
Hyundai is investing $21 billion in the U.S. to enhance electric vehicle production, modernize facilities, and drive innovation, creating thousands of skilled jobs and supporting sustainable mobility.
An AI startup hosted a hackathon to test smart city tools in simulated urban conditions, uncovering insights, creative ideas, and practical improvements for more inclusive cities.
Researchers fine-tune billion-parameter AI models to adapt them for specific, real-world tasks. Learn how fine-tuning techniques make these massive systems efficient, reliable, and practical for healthcare, law, and beyond.
How AI is shaping the 2025 Masters Tournament with IBM’s enhanced features and how Meta’s Llama 4 models are redefining open-source innovation.
Discover how next-generation technology is redefining NFL stadiums with AI-powered systems that enhance crowd flow, fan experience, and operational efficiency.
Gartner forecasts task-specific AI will outperform general AI by 2027, driven by its precision and practicality. Discover the reasons behind this shift and its impact on the future of artificial intelligence.
Hugging Face has entered the humanoid robots market following its acquisition of a robotics firm, blending advanced AI with lifelike machines for homes, education, and healthcare.